Leinefelde

Completed: 1999

Reconstruction of two L-shaped panel buildings marked the beginning of large-scale renovation of the Soviet legacy in a small town in East Germany, Leinefelde. A key element in the design was the masonry on the first level, which performs several functions: provides the foundation building, allowing you to create elevated private gardens at ground level, and establishes a kind of barrier, a buffer zone between the building and the street.

Leinefelde

Floor area: 4, 2 sq.. m

Completed in 2004

The most striking and radical reconstruction in Leinefelde example, in eastern Germany, is the transformation of the old panel houses "Plattenbau" length of 180 m. Remove the top floor and the seven segments of the block along the line, the architects of Stefan Forster Architekten introduced a new style of residential development. On the basis of the old house Multi-family villas were created.

Leinefelde

Floor area: 2, 2 sq.. m

Completed in 2002

Shestietazhku panel during the reconstruction was reduced to four floors, added stonework on the building perimeter for visual consolidation of the building and its external space. The house has reduced the number of apartments in the remaining did modern and comfortable layout.

Leinefelde

Floor area: 2, 6 sq.. m

Completed in 2006

The five-storey Khrushchev was reduced to three floors. The building was originally very long. During the renovation of the quarter, it removed the central segment - the result was two separate buildings.
